What is the Varanasi Ring Road?

The Varanasi Ring Road is a multi-lane bypass corridor developed to divert heavy vehicles away from the city's crowded roads. The project is being developed under the National Highways Authority of India (NHAI) to improve connectivity between major national highways while reducing travel time within and around Varanasi.

The Ring Road connects important highways leading towards:

  • Lucknow
  • Prayagraj
  • Ghazipur
  • Gorakhpur
  • Azamgarh
  • Mirzapur
  • Jaunpur
  • Patna

It also provides smoother access to important transport corridors in eastern India.

Important Exits on Varanasi Ring Road

The Ring Road connects several important destinations through strategically located interchanges and exits.

Key access points include:

  • Babatpur Airport Road
  • NH-19 Junction
  • Azamgarh Road
  • Ghazipur Road
  • Jaunpur Road
  • Mirzapur Road
  • Industrial Area Access
  • Local village connectors

These exits improve accessibility for passengers, freight transport, and local businesses.
